Webb28 jan. 2012 · Philippine Daily Inquirer / 12:14 AM January 28, 2012. Poverty definitely fell in the last quarter of 2011, as household heads rating their families as mahirap (poor) were only 45 percent in the Dec. 3-7, 2011 Social Weather Survey, a significant 7-point drop from the 52 percent recorded in the previous quarterly SWS survey done on Sept. 4-7, 2011.
